Prince Charles to rest to fight illness

HEIR to the British throne Prince Charles has been advised by his doctor to take three days off next week to nurse a persistent chest infection, a spokeswoman for the Royal Household sai.

He has cancelled an appearance at Royal Ascot and the traditional Garter Service at Windsor Castle to convalesce from next Monday. He will return to his usual duties and diary of public engagements on Thursday.

"The Prince has been suffering from a persistent chest infection for over a month and doctors have advised him to find a number of consecutive days in which to have a complete rest," a spokeswoman for the palace said.

She said despite his ill-health Prince Charles, 61, had decided to honour a number of long-standing commitments this week, including taking part in the Queen Elizabeth's Birthday Parade.
